Taxonomic rank - Wikipedia

WebIn biology, taxonomic rank is the relative level of a group of organisms (a taxon) in an ancestral or hereditary hierarchy. A common system of biological classification ( taxonomy) consists of species, genus, family, order, class, phylum, kingdom, domain. WebApr 9, 2024 · Organisms can be classified into one of three domains based on differences in the sequences of nucleotides in the cell's ribosomal RNAs (rRNA), the cell's membrane lipid structure, and its sensitivity to antibiotics. The three domains are the Archaea, the Bacteria, and the Eukarya. how do you identify a rat snake https://branderdesignstudio.com

The number of species in genera varies considerably among taxonomic groups. For instance, among (non-avian) reptiles, which have about 1180 genera, the most (>300) have only 1 species, ~360 have between 2 and 4 species, 260 have 5–10 species, ~200 have 11–50 species, and only 27 genera have more than 50 species. WebA family is part of the classification of living organisms. It is a group of similar genera of taxonomic rank below order and above genus. Family names are printed in Roman (ordinary) letters with an initial capital; for example, Felidae is the family of all cats. Genus Genus is a taxonomic category ranking below family and above species. Webis a subdivision of a genus (a group of very similar species) ; a super-family is a group of similar families (a subdivision of an order). A tribe (sometimes used in botanical classifications) is a subdivision of a family. There may be any number from one to many species in a genus, genera in a family, families in an order, and so on.
